Action item (postmortem INC-(Lanternfall)): The Switchvane flag framework allowed a 100% rollout without a staged ramp, which caused the cache stampede. Owner: platform team, due next sprint. Work: enforce mandatory ramp stages (1/10/50/100) for flags tagged high-risk, add an approval gate for skipping stages, and emit an audit event on every percentage change. Verification is a dry-run in staging with the stampede replay harness. Design notes and rollout checklist are on the page below.

runbook for badug-kadup: https://confluence.zemvarlabs.internal/projects/browse/display/projects/bd1b

For review: preview renders of Inkmarrow templates are taking 4–6 seconds versus ~200ms in production. Root cause is that the preview environment was cloned without the fragment-cache settings, so every render recompiles all partials from scratch. The fix in this PR sets `INKMARROW_CACHE_MODE=persistent` and bumps the compile worker count. One manual step remains that the pipeline can't do automatically: the cache backend requires an access credential, so in the preview `.env` add the following line:

sealed setting: ARCHIVE_KEY3=8d0

Ticket #2093 — Door Sensor Recall

The Helvane-series door sensors installed on floors three through five are being recalled due to intermittent latch failures. Replacement units arrive Thursday; affected doors will run in manual mode until then. Team assistants should remind staff not to prop these doors open and to report any that fail to relock. While the sensors are offline, the stairwell doors on those floors can be opened with the code below.

badge for fafop-fajof: bdg-Z-47

- [ ] Verify the Quillset component library bump follows strict semver: no breaking prop changes under a minor version. Check the changelog diff against the public API snapshot. Reject any release that vendors patched third-party code without a pinned hash. Record approval against the release token below.

session token of bagag-fafop = htk21_cbc501024a787b9031ac6